£79,500 is the median sold price in Trinity Road, Bootle — not an estimate, but what buyers really paid. Over the past decade prices are +50% in cash — but +7% once inflation is stripped out.

Trinity Road, Bootle house prices — your questions

What is the average house price in Trinity Road, Bootle?

Half of homes sold in Trinity Road, Bootle went for more than £79,500 and half for less, across 96 sales.

What is the price range of homes sold in Trinity Road, Bootle?

Recorded sales in Trinity Road, Bootle range from £27,500 to £285,000. The range includes flats and large detached homes alike.

Have house prices in Trinity Road, Bootle risen?

Over the past decade prices in Trinity Road, Bootle are +50% in cash terms but +7% once adjusted for inflation using ONS CPIH — the gap between the two is the real story.

How much is a house per square metre in Trinity Road, Bootle?

In Trinity Road, Bootle the median price is £1,104 per square metre, from 38 sales matched to an EPC floor-area record.

How up to date is this data?

HM Land Registry publishes Price Paid Data monthly. The most recent sale recorded in Trinity Road, Bootle was 28 November 2025.
